Sheikhupura: More than 20 people have suffered injuries due to toxic gas leakage from a cylinder in Shaikhupura, district of Punjab.
According to the police, the incident of toxic gas spillage from the cylinder took place in Ferozwala village, where more than 20 people, including women and children, were injured.
The police said that soon after receiving the news of poisonous gas, rescue, police and aid teams arrived the spot and shifted all the people in semi-conscious state to District Headquarters Hospital, while two accused have been detained.
